It is with deep sorrow that we announce the death of Clara Nadeau (Westminster, Massachusetts), born in Saint Paul, New Brunswick, who passed away on September 4, 2018, at the age of 88, leaving to mourn family and friends. Leave a sympathy message to the family in the guestbook on this memorial page of Clara Nadeau to show support.

She was predeceased by: her grandson Nathan Vandesteen; her siblings, Alfred Goguen, Edgar Goguen, Raymond Goguen, Ernest Goguen, Lydia Hamel and Dora Pelletier; and her parent Henry Goguen.

She is survived by: her husband Enoil Nadeau; her children, Michael Nadeau, Andre Nadeau, Susan Nadeau Thompson, Jeannie Nadeau Martin, Lisa Nadeau Graves of Natick and Rachel Nadeau Gonzalez; her siblings, Clarence Goguen of Canada, Henry Goguen, Lawrence Goguen, Eleanor Gariepy, Catherine Poirier, Bertha LeBlanc and Jeannette Davis; and her parent Mary Jane Goguen (Leblanc). She is also survived by nine grandsons; four granddaughters; five great-grandsons.

In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ions can be made to Catholic Charities of Worcester County, 12 Riverbend Street, Athol, MA 01331.
